Eye problems?!

Hi everyone!

I had my sleeve surgery on sept 2013.... I reached my weight goal, and no diabetes or hbp meds!

But, Im very concerned and want to know if anyone have vision or eye problems? I use eye glasses and contact lenses for long time ago....but 4 months after the surgery I began to notice a change in my left eye...Now its worse! My left eye crossed when I try to focus at distance....I saw 2 eye doctors and they cant tell me whats wrong with my eye! I'm desperate because I even drive my car.....anyone with this issue?!

Thank you so much!!

There's an archived article that addresses vision issues after WLS on OAC's website. It talks about Vitamin A deficiencies as a possible cause (but you can get too much Vitamin A, which also has effects on vision). You may want to ask about having your levels checked.
